Resilient Growers: a cyber-secure and sustainable horticulture sector through digital data innovation
Resilient Growers is a sector-wide project of Cyberweerbaarheidscentrum Greenport (CW Greenport), initiated by Greenport West-Holland and Security Delta (HSD) in collaboration with Banken Champignons, L.A. van Schie, and GroentenFruit Huis. Together with growers, IT suppliers, sector organisations and ecosystem partners, the project aims to strengthen the cyber resilience and future readiness of the Dutch horticulture sector.
Resilient Growers combines cyber threat intelligence from national authorities with signals from daily practice in the sector. These insights are translated into practical actions and recommendations, helping horticultural businesses better prepare for cyber threats and digital disruptions.
A key element is the development of a structured approach for collecting and securely sharing cyber threat intelligence within the sector. A pilot group of growers and IT suppliers, including Koppert Cress, Rovecom and BXTR, is testing and refining this approach. Other organisations involved include Royal Zon, Meeder Group, Nature’s Pride, Greenports Nederland, Greenport Gelderland, Greenport Boskoop and Glastuinbouw Nederland.
By connecting data, expertise and practical experience, Resilient Growers contributes to a more secure, resilient and future-ready Dutch horticulture sector.
Implementation of the project is made possible in part through funding from RVO, commissioned by the Ministry of Agriculture, Fisheries, Food Security and Nature (LVVN), and the European Union.
